June Lockhart, beloved for her roles as a mom in Lassie and in Lost in Space, died on Oct. 23 at her Santa Monica, California residence of pure causes. She was 100.
Harlon Ball, Lockhart’s spokesman, confirmed her loss of life to The New York Times.
Lockhart made an indelible mark taking part in Ruth Martin, the foster mom of John Provost’s character, Timmy, and his collie Lassie, on the collection Lassie starting in 1958. She took over the function from Cloris Leachman within the present’s fifth season, and he or she remained on the present via 1964.
She went on to star as Dr. Maureen Robinson — a biochemist, spouse, and mom — within the sci-fi journey tv collection, Lost in Space. She appeared in all three seasons of its run, from 1965 via 1968, alongside her household of house castaways, which included a robotic who warned “Danger, Will Robinson” to her character’s precocious son (Bill Mumy) at any time when a menace was perceived. In 2024, Lockhart revealed that taking part in Robinson was her favourite function. “It was so campy,” she instructed Closer Weekly. “And I truly enjoyed my relationship with my space family.”
She went on to hitch Petticoat Junction in its sixth season in 1968, the place she portrayed Janet Craig and continued the function till the collection led to 1970.
While she grew to become extensively identified for her roles within the Sixties, she had already gained a Tony Award for Best Performance by a Newcomer (the class now not exists) for her Broadway debut in For Love or Money in 1948 when she was 22 years outdated. She made her huge display screen debut even earlier, at age 13, when she appeared in an uncredited function within the 1938 model of A Christmas Carol, alongside her actor dad and mom Gene Lockhart and Kathleen Lockhart.
Through the course of eight many years, the actress portrayed a spread of roles on the small and large display screen, showing in movies together with Son of Lassie, the 1945 sequel to Lassie Come Home and a precursor to her tv function; All This, and Heaven Too; Meet Me in St. Louis; The Yearling; and Sergeant York. On tv, she had recurring roles on the daytime cleaning soap opera General Hospital and Beverly Hills 90210, and was a visitor star on exhibits comparable to Happy Days, Full House, and Grey’s Anatomy. She most not too long ago appeared within the movies Zombie Hamlet (2012) and The Remake (2016). She additionally voiced Mindy the Owl in 2019’s animated Bongee Bear and the Kingdom of Rhythm and voiced Alpha Control within the third season of Netflix’s reboot of Lost in Space in 2021.
She was nominated for 2 Emmys, together with Best Actress in a Leading Role in a Dramatic Series for her efficiency in Lassie. Lockhart was additionally the recipient of two stars on the Hollywood Walk of Fame, one recognizing her movement image work, the opposite honoring her tv profession.
